How Does a Commercial Fire Alarm Monitoring System Actually Work?
The system operates in a clear sequence.
Detection
Smoke detectors, heat sensors, pull stations, or sprinkler flow switches sense danger.
Signal Transmission
The fire alarm control panel sends a signal through a secure communication path. This may include cellular, radio, or internet based connections.
Central Station Response
A monitoring center receives the signal instantly. Operators review the account details and contact emergency responders.
Notification
Property owners or managers receive calls or alerts, so they remain informed while responders head to the site.
Because every second counts, redundancy matters. Therefore, modern systems often include dual communication paths. If one line fails, another carries the signal. Common Challenges in Commercial Fire Alarm Monitoring
Even well designed systems face challenges. Construction changes can disrupt wiring. Internet upgrades may affect communication modules. Power outages test battery backups.
Therefore, proactive maintenance plays a central role. Regular testing identifies weak batteries, outdated firmware, or damaged devices before they cause trouble signals. Additionally, updating contact lists ensures monitoring operators reach the right person during an emergency.
Another frequent issue involves false alarms. While no system can eliminate them entirely, proper calibration and maintenance reduce unnecessary dispatches. Kord Fire Protection technicians work with property managers to identify causes, whether dust buildup, steam near detectors, or equipment placement. By addressing root causes, they protect both safety and reputation.
After all, repeated false alarms can lead to fines. More importantly, they risk complacency. When people assume an alarm is always false, response slows. And in fire safety, slow is not an option.
Future Trends in Commercial Fire Protection
Technology continues to shape the landscape of commercial fire protection in Lomita. Modern panels now integrate with building management systems. Remote diagnostics allow technicians to review system status without waiting for an on site visit. Cloud based reporting improves record keeping.
Additionally, cellular communication has become more common as traditional phone lines fade. This shift increases reliability and speeds signal transmission. As networks evolve, so do monitoring methods.
